It's easy to make mistakes when picking a local IT company. Here are some of the most common pitfalls and how you can avoid them.
Many businesses overlook cybersecurity when choosing an IT partner. Without strong security, your data and systems are at risk. Make sure your provider offers regular security assessments and keeps up with current threats.
Choosing the cheapest option can cost more in the long run. Low-cost providers may cut corners on support or use outdated technology. Look for value, not just price.
Some companies think they only need help when something breaks. Managed IT services offer ongoing support, proactive monitoring, and regular maintenance, which can prevent bigger problems down the road.
Experience matters. Ask about their track record with businesses similar to yours. A company with experience in your industry will understand your challenges and offer better solutions.
Always ask for references. Talking to other clients can reveal how reliable and responsive the IT company is. Good providers are happy to share customer feedback.
Your business will grow and change. Make sure your IT partner can scale their services to match your needs, whether you add new locations or expand your team.
Check if the IT company offers 24/7 support or only works during business hours. Fast help desk support can make a big difference when problems arise.

Selecting the right IT partner is a process. Here are the key steps to follow to make a smart choice.
Start by listing your current technology challenges and future goals. This will help you find a provider that matches your requirements.
Look for companies with a strong reputation and a track record of helping businesses like yours. Check online reviews and ask for case studies.
Make sure the IT company offers the services you need, such as cloud solutions, network security, and help desk support. A wide range of options means they can grow with you.
Reliable technical support is essential. Find out how quickly they respond to issues and if they offer on-site assistance when needed.
Ask how the provider handles data backup and disaster recovery. A solid plan will protect your business from unexpected events.
Choose a partner that helps you streamline your processes and optimize your technology investments. This can save money and improve productivity.
Your IT company should be able to integrate new systems with your existing setup without causing disruptions. This ensures your business runs smoothly during upgrades or changes.

Once you've chosen your IT partner, there are steps you can take to get the most value from the relationship. Start by setting clear expectations and communication channels. Regular check-ins help you stay on top of issues and plan for future needs.
Ask your provider to review your network security and cloud computing setup regularly. This proactive approach can prevent problems before they start. Also, make sure your team knows how to contact the help desk support for quick solutions to everyday problems.

Cybersecurity protects your data and systems from threats like hacking and malware. A managed service provider with a strong cybersecurity focus will regularly update your defenses and train your staff on best practices.
Cloud computing and data backup are also key parts of a solid cybersecurity plan. These tools help you recover quickly if something goes wrong and keep your business running smoothly.
Local IT companies often provide backup and recovery services to protect your data. They create regular backups and have plans in place to restore your systems quickly after an incident.
Disaster recovery is more than just backups—it's about minimizing downtime and making sure your business can keep operating. Look for companies that offer seamless solutions and test their recovery plans regularly.
